What Is a Separation Agreement?
A separation agreement is a legally binding contract between spouses who are living apart but not yet divorced. This agreement outlines how spouses will divide assets and debts, handle child custody and visitation, and address spousal support. While a separation agreement does not end the marriage, it can serve as a roadmap for managing the separation period and can later be incorporated into a divorce decree if the marriage ends.
Separation agreements are particularly useful for couples who want to minimize conflict, protect their financial interests, and provide clear guidelines for co-parenting. They can also prevent disputes from escalating and reduce the time and expense of court proceedings.

Key Elements of a Separation Agreement in Dayton
A comprehensive separation agreement in Dayton, Ohio, typically addresses the following issues:
- Division of Property and Assets: How marital property, savings, investments, and personal belongings will be divided.
- Debt Allocation: Determining responsibility for shared debts, loans, and credit cards.
- Spousal Support (Alimony): Whether one spouse will pay support to the other, and if so, the amount and duration.
- Child Custody and Parenting Time: Agreements on legal custody, physical custody, visitation schedules, and decision-making responsibilities.
- Child Support: Guidelines for financial support of minor children, in accordance with Ohio child support laws.
- Health Insurance and Benefits: Decisions regarding coverage for spouses and children during the separation period.
By clearly addressing these issues, a separation agreement can prevent misunderstandings and provide both parties with certainty during a difficult time.
